"When I do play, I have troubles getting to the low notes and most definitely to the higher octaves. Lots of squacking and squeaking going on.
Again...probably embrochure problems."
Possibly your mouthpiece has nicks on it that allow for uncontrolled wind that produces squeaks. The most important part of your clarinet is your mouthpiece. Maybe that old mpc needs replaced. Then, find a soft 2 or 2 1/2 reed (Ricos are fine) that works with it. As, stated above, make sure your pads and corks are tight. Best of luck, and practice, practice, practice.
